Compare The Crossings to Fort Pierce

This post compares The Crossings, Florida to Fort Pierce, Florida across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ension The Crossings (CDP) Fort Pierce (city)
Population 23,062 44,248
Income (median) $45,994 $28,691
Home Value (median) $267,800 $91,400
White 88% 57%
Black 4% 36%
Asian 2% 0%
With Kids 32% 31%
Age (median) 40 36
Rentals 22% 53%

Questions and Answers:

Q: Which is more populated, The Crossings or Fort Pierce?
A: The Crossings has a smaller population count than Fort Pierce: 23062 compared with 44248 total people.

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in The Crossings or in Fort Pierce?
A: Incomes are on average much higher in The Crossings.

Q: Are homes more expensive in The Crossings or Fort Pierce?
A: Homes tend to be much more expensive in The Crossings.

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: Fort Pierce does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 22% for The Crossings versus 53% for Fort Pierce.
